Park Nicollet is an integrated care system that includes Methodist Hospital, Park Nicollet Clinic, Park Nicollet Foundation, Park Nicollet Institute and TRIA Orthopaedic Center. Park Nicollet is based in St. Louis Park, Minnesota and has more than 8,200 team members. (Our LinkedIn guidelines: http://bit.ly/1sKdEqh)

The close connection between Dr. Levi Downs’s grandmother and her physician during a terminal illness is what drew Dr. Downs to medicine. A gynecologic oncologist at Park Nicollet, Dr. Downs is a 2024 Mpls.St.Paul Magazine Top Doctor and featured on cover on the magazine’s 2024 Top Doctors issue. “Years ago, when my grandmother was dying of cancer, I was moved by the close connection between her, my mother – her caregiver – and my grandmother’s physician. This left an impression on me and showed how important establishing connections with patients is while also providing their care,” Downs said. “I’m often treating patients who are frightened so to be able to support them through the ups and downs is rewarding.” Read more about Dr. Downs in Mpls.
